Almanacco Topolino #71
In "Bacicin riprende il mare," years after their last pirate escapade, Donald Duck finds himself back at sea when the parrot Yellow Beak arrives with a fresh treasure map. With Uncle Scrooge eager to claim his share and the Beagle Boys hot on their heels, the hunt for Pirate Gold is reignited — and this time, the waters are as treacherous as ever.
In "Paperino e gli indiani Paperuti," Zio Paperone journeys to the South American village of the Cura de Coco Indians in search of rare nutmegs for his favorite tea. Donald, sent by the Tutor Corps to teach farming, ends up teaching the villagers how to play bongo drums instead—and accidentally helps a witch doctor concoct a potion that reverses size. When the brew is accidentally dumped into a river, it unleashes giant wildlife that sends Scrooge and his family scrambling for survival, all while trying to hold onto the precious nutmegs.
